What is the Asia-Pacific Amateur Championship?
So, what exactly is this prestigious event? The Asia-Pacific Amateur Championship is a premier amateur golf tournament, jointly organized by the Masters Tournament, the R&A, and the Asia Pacific Golf Confederation. It's designed to promote the game of golf in the Asia-Pacific region and provide a pathway for talented amateurs to compete against the best in the world. The tournament features a field of the top amateur golfers from across the Asia-Pacific, showcasing incredible skill and fierce competition. The History and Origins of the AAC
The story of the Asia-Pacific Amateur Championship begins in 2009. The Masters Tournament, the R&A, and the Asia Pacific Golf Confederation recognized a growing need to foster and develop golf in the Asia-Pacific region. They saw a vast potential of untapped talent and wanted to create a platform that would help these golfers reach their full potential. They envisioned a tournament that would provide these players with opportunities to compete at the highest level, gain experience, and showcase their skills on a global stage. This vision was realized with the inception of the AAC. The tournament's establishment was a significant step toward the globalization of golf, giving players from the Asia-Pacific region a chance to shine and demonstrate their abilities. The AAC quickly became a beacon of hope for aspiring golfers, providing a direct pathway to major championships and opening doors to a world of opportunity. The early years of the tournament were marked by excitement and anticipation as young golfers from across the region competed for the coveted title.
The inaugural tournament was held at Mission Hills Golf Club in Shenzhen, China. From the very beginning, the AAC captured the attention of golf enthusiasts worldwide. Key Benefits of Winning the AAC
Okay, guys, here's where it gets really interesting! What's in it for the winner of the Asia-Pacific Amateur Championship? The rewards are huge, and they can completely change a young golfer's career. The winner gets a guaranteed spot in the Masters Tournament and the Open Championship the following year. Can you imagine? Playing alongside the biggest names in golf at some of the most iconic courses in the world! It's a dream come true for any aspiring golfer.
But that's not all! The winner also receives an invitation to the Open Qualifying Series, offering a chance to compete for a spot in other major championships. This can be a game-changer, giving the champion even more exposure and opportunities to further develop their skills and experience. Plus, the winner gets automatic entry into the Amateur Championship and the U.S. Amateur Championship. These are prestigious tournaments that can catapult a golfer's career to the next level.

Notable Winners and Their Success Stories
Now, let's talk about some of the Asia-Pacific Amateur Championship winners who have made it big. These are the guys who took their AAC victories and ran with them, making names for themselves on the professional stage. These are the success stories that prove the value of the tournament and show how it can launch careers.
- Hideki Matsuyama: Probably the most famous success story, Hideki Matsuyama won the AAC twice, in 2010 and 2011. He's gone on to become a multiple-time PGA Tour winner and a Masters champion in 2021.
